
Give an example of a gliding joint.

Hint: Joints are the contact point between the bones and the cartilages. These are responsible for the movement of the bones. Most of the joints in the human body are synovial joints and they are present in the areas where the frequent and easy mobility is important.
Complete step by step answer:
Joints are classified into three types based on its mobility. They are synovial joint, fibrous joints and cartilaginous joints. Synovial joints are freely movable because they are filled with fluid in its synovial cavity. And hence it is known as freely movable joints. Fibrous joints are fixed in nature and cartilaginous joints are neither fixed nor freely movable, they are slightly movable in nature.
Of all the three, synovial joints have increased mobility. Cells of the synovial joint secrete synovial fluid that provide lubrication for the easy movement of the bone. Gliding joints are one of the types of synovial joints that meet each other at the flat articular areas. They are provided with the ligaments between them. They provide the movement in which the bones glide each other and give little movement in every direction.
Zygapophyses of adjacent vertebrae are an example of gliding joints.
Note:
Ball and socket joints, ellipsoidal joints, gliding joints, hinge joints, saddle joints are the type of the synovial joints.
Joints that are present at the wrist, ankles. Between the carpals, zygapophyses of adjacent vertebrae are the examples of the gliding joints
